Asbestos victims are entitled to compensation for their illnesses, including lost wages, medical bills and suffering. They may also be entitled to wrongful-death compensation in the event that a loved one has died from mesothelioma or another asbestos-related disease.

Many companies that made use of asbestos have set trust funds to pay for the expenses of asbestos victims. The mesothelioma lawyers of these firms can assist victims in determining whether they are eligible to make claims against these asbestos trust funds. These lawyers can also help victims claim compensation against asbestos product manufacturers, suppliers, and asbestos job sites who exposed them to asbestos.

Jury Verdicts

A mesothelioma lawyer firm with a track record of success is likely to have the experience of obtaining large verdicts for their clients. Mesothelioma cases are usually settled outside of court. However certain cases go to trial where the judge or jury may give compensation to the plaintiff. The track record of the lawyer and expertise will determine if a verdict at trial is the best option.

Settlements tend to be faster than trials, and can allow victims to receive compensation faster. However, a trial verdict can result in higher total compensation amounts than a settlement. A mesothelioma lawyer will weigh the pros and cons based on your situation to help you determine the best option for you and your loved ones.

A mesothelioma court verdict permits lawyers to present witnesses and evidence in person, which can make the case more compelling to jurors. Trials can be more costly and lengthy than settlements.

Additionally, the jury's decision is final, which could be stressful for the victim and their loved ones. Having an experienced mesothelioma law attorney will ensure that the process goes as smooth as it can be and increase your chances of getting a favorable outcome.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ience has the resources to investigate your claim and collect evidence for trial. This could include medical records, military and work service records, as well as the list of asbestos-containing items you were exposed to along with their manufacturers.

The firm's attorneys will be able to help you determine your levels of exposure and the different kinds of asbestos-related diseases. They can also explain the statute of limitations and how it affects your legal rights.
